EasyC in crossover

Has anyone had any success with installing EasyC in a Wine type of environment (either mac/linux)? When I tried to install it it crashed right at the end, and displayed a simple display box saying it cannot start.

I couldn't tell from your post what your host system was, but it works well in VMWare Server which is free for Linux users. So you could install a windows VM with VMWare, then install all the easyC tools and you'll be in business.
